site stats

Multiply instruction

WebIn this topic, we will multiply and divide whole numbers. The topic starts with 1-digit multiplication and division and goes through multi-digit problems. We will cover … http://www-mdp.eng.cam.ac.uk/web/library/enginfo/mdp_micro/lecture5/lecture5-2.html

How to perform multiplication in MPLAB IDE - YouTube

WebThe mul instruction multiplies the contents of general-purpose register (GPR) RA and GPR RB, and stores bits 0-31 of the result in the target GPR RT and bits 32-63 of the result in … WebThe action of this instruction and the location of the result depends on the opcode and the operand size as shown in Table 4-9. The result is stored in register AX, register pair DX:AX, or register pair EDX:EAX (depending on the operand size), with the high-order bits of the product contained in register AH, DX, or EDX, respectively. malibu pilates pro chair with handles https://principlemed.net

MIPS Assembly/Instruction Formats - Wikibooks

WebThe MUL, also known as the multiply, is an instruction which will perform a mathematical multiplication of two integers or floats. This mathematical instruction will be executed … WebThe multiply implementation can include lookup tables and interpolation methods at a very high cost of silicon, but this brings it near performance for an adder. For the ARM32, there are instructions that are multiplies by fixed constants. ie, add r0, … Web26 mar. 2024 · Multiply the bottom one's number by the number of the top ten. Use the same bottom number and multiply it by the number of the top ten. Then write the result … malibu pilates chair workout chart

Microprocessor - 8086 Instruction Sets - TutorialsPoint

Category:arduino - What is meant by

Tags:Multiply instruction

Multiply instruction

3.4: Multiplication in MIPS Assembly - Engineering LibreTexts

WebHaving a genuine multiply instruction is better than nothing, even if it is slow in first versions/low end variants, because it can be more easily enhanced than series of additions and shift instructions, or relying on dynamic patching of code depending on CPU versions (replacing the multiply subroutine call by a call to a single a multiply … Web7 mai 2024 · Higher end 16 and 32 bit processor cores on the other hand typically did have hardware multiply instructions and furthermore worked with larger data word sizes. Some of the high-end 8 bit (data word size) micro-controller architectures such as the "atmega32" and the "pic18" decided to add a multiply instruction. Since this was a new feature for ...

Multiply instruction

Did you know?

WebMultiplication of two n -bit numbers can in fact be done in O (log n) circuit depth, just like addition. Addition in O (log n) is done by splitting the number in half and (recursively) adding the two parts in parallel, where the upper half is solved for … Web7 apr. 2024 · In the multiplication of integers, you have the following properties: Closure Property: The multiplication value of two integers is always an integer. According to the …

WebThere are multiply instructions that operate on 32-bit or 64-bit values and return a result of the same size as the operands. For example, two 64-bit registers can be multiplied to … WebUsage. The MUL instruction multiplies the values from Rm and Rs, and places the least significant 32 bits of the result in Rd. The MLA instruction multiplies the values from Rm …

WebHow to multiply. Multiplication is one of the four basic arithmetic operations, with the other three being subtraction, addition, and division.Learning how to multiply is a necessary … Web10 mai 2024 · It has many other variant multiplication instructions as well. It does not, however, compute the remainder of a division. ARM A64 redefines SMULL and UMULL to store the 64-bit product of two 32-bit integers in a 64-bit register. It has no 64-bit multiply instruction, per se. To multiply, you do a multiply-add that adds the zero register.

Web2 ian. 2024 · The simplest way to begin teaching multiplication is to anchor the concept in terms of its relation to addition -- an operation your students should already be …

WebCarry-less Multiplication ( CLMUL) is an extension to the x86 instruction set used by microprocessors from Intel and AMD which was proposed by Intel in March 2008 [1] and … malibu plastic lightsWebCarry-less Multiplication ( CLMUL) is an extension to the x86 instruction set used by microprocessors from Intel and AMD which was proposed by Intel in March 2008 [1] and made available in the Intel Westmere processors announced in early 2010. Mathematically, the instruction implements multiplication of polynomials over the finite field GF (2 ... malibu plastic bottleWebARM multiply instructions. This section contains the following subsections: MUL and MLA. Multiply and multiply-accumulate (32-bit by 32-bit, bottom 32-bit result). UMULL, … malibu player midnight satinWebHow to write an instruction to multiply two 8-bit numbers stored in data memory 0x10 and 0x11. Place the result of the product in 0x20 and 0x21.Assignment 2,... malibu planning project plan cover sheetWebDoing an 8-bit multiply using the hardware multiplier is simple, as the examples in this chapter will clearly show. Just load the operands into two registers (or only one for square multiply) and execute one of the multiply instructions. The result will be placed in register pair R0:R1. However, note that only the MUL malibu planning commissionWebMUL (Multiply) is the simplest multiplication instruction. It multiplies two 32-bit numbers (held in registers) and stores a 32-bit result in a destination register. If the operands are signed, the result will be signed also. Multiplying two 32-bit numbers together gives rise to a 64-bit number. malibu pottery and tileWebMultiplication Instructions Multiply Real (fmul) fmul{ls} Example. Multiply stack element 7 by stack element 0 and return the product to stack element 0. fmul %st(7), %st … malibu power pack photo eye sensor